CAPE GIRARDEAU, Mo., (KBSI) — Volunteers are helping provide healthy meals to local families this summer through the Tiger Bites Summer Feeding Program, according to the Saint Francis Foundation.

The program serves 36 families in the community and is designed to provide additional food support during the summer months when school is not in session.

Saint Francis Foundation recognized community partners who help make the program possible, including Schnucks-Cape Girardeau, Drury Southwest Inc., Pratt Industries and Jefferson Elementary School.

Foundation officials said volunteers work each week to pack and deliver nutritious meals to participating families.

The Tiger Bites program is part of ongoing efforts to address food insecurity and support children and families throughout the Cape Girardeau area.
